TLV2772ID by Texas Instruments

TLV2772ID by Texas Instruments is a CMOS Operational Amplifier with 2 functions, offering low bias and high slew rate of 4.7 V/us. It has a max supply voltage limit of 7V and operates in automotive-grade temperatures up to 125°C. Ideal for applications requiring precise signal amplification in compact designs.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

The use of plastic/epoxy material in the package body makes the product lightweight and durable, suitable for various applications.

Maximum Input Offset Voltage: 2700 uV

The low maximum input offset voltage ensures accurate signal processing and minimal errors in the output.

Maximum Average Bias Current (IIB): 0.00035 uA

The low maximum average bias current results in low power consumption and improved efficiency of the operational amplifier.

Surface Mount: YES

The surface mount feature allows for easy and convenient installation on PCBs, saving space and simplifying production processes.

Nominal Common Mode Reject Ratio: 82 dB

The high common mode reject ratio ensures that noise and interference are minimized, resulting in cleaner output signals.

Nominal Supply Voltage / Vsup (V): 2.7

The nominal supply voltage of 2.7V makes this operational amplifier suitable for low power applications and battery-powered devices.

Minimum Slew Rate: 4.7 V/us

The minimum slew rate of 4.7 V/us indicates the fast response time of the amplifier to input signal changes, making it suitable for high-frequency applications.

Maximum Supply Voltage Limit: 7 V

The maximum supply voltage limit of 7V ensures the safe operation of the amplifier within specified voltage ranges to prevent damage.

Temperature Grade: AUTOMOTIVE

The automotive grade temperature range makes this operational amplifier suitable for automotive applications where temperature fluctuations are common.

Nominal Unity Gain Bandwidth: 4800 kHz

The high unity gain bandwidth allows for efficient amplification of signals without distortion, making it ideal for high-speed signal processing.

Manufacturer Highlights

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
